SAN data recovery is the process of restoring lost, deleted, or inaccessible block-level data from a Storage Area Network, where storage is presented to servers as logical units called LUNs rather than as individual drives. Unlike a single hard drive or NAS device, a SAN pools multiple disks across RAID groups (0, 1, 3, or 5), controller hardware, and LUN abstraction layers, so a single failure can cascade across VMs, databases, and applications at once. Isolate the SAN, preserve drive order, and do not touch the controller interface until a specialist has assessed the situation.

SAN recovery differs fundamentally from standard drive or NAS recovery because the failure chain is multi-layered. A corrupted LUN may look like a physical disk failure, but the actual cause could be firmware corruption, a RAID controller fault, or a bad metadata write during a volume expansion. Attempting to rebuild the array through the SAN’s management interface can overwrite RAID metadata and make professional recovery impossible.
Failures split into two categories with very different outlooks:
- Logical failures (corrupt LUNs, deleted volumes, APFS file-system damage, accidental reformats) carry a high recovery rate when a specialist intervenes quickly with low-level read-only tools.
- Physical failures (controller board failure, NVMe or SSD media damage, power surge) require sector-level imaging before any reconstruction begins.
Pro Tip: Never save recovered files back onto the original SAN volume. Export to a separate, verified device to avoid overwriting the evidence the lab needs.

The recovery workflow follows a staged, forensic approach:
- Secure intake with chain-of-custody documentation and restricted lab access
- Sector-level imaging of every drive member before any reconstruction, prioritizing unstable media
- Virtual RAID/LUN reconstruction, determining stripe size, parity rotation, disk order, and any snapshot or thin-provisioning layers
- File-system repair, including APFS containers, CoreStorage, and VMFS/VMDK cases for Mac-hosted VMs
- Integrity verification of recovered files before delivery
- Encrypted, secure delivery to alternate storage, never back to the original volume

Failure type vs. recovery prospects

| Failure type | Common causes | Typical recovery outlook |
|---|---|---|
| Logical | Corrupt LUN, deleted volume, APFS damage | High, when handled quickly in read-only mode |
| Physical | Controller failure, NVMe/SSD media damage | Moderate; depends on imaging success |
| Mixed (logical + physical) | Power surge, firmware corruption + disk failure | Variable; staged lab process required |
When to call immediately: multiple drives offline, controller not recognizing LUNs, VMs inaccessible, or any RAID rebuild prompt appearing on screen. If backups are intact and only one non-critical volume is affected, verify the backup first before calling.

What is the difference between SAN, NAS, and direct-attached storage?
A SAN uses block-level storage presented as LUNs over a dedicated high-speed network; NAS uses file-level storage over Ethernet; DAS connects directly to one host. SAN recovery is the most complex of the three because of RAID metadata, controller abstraction, and LUN mapping layers.
